What is the cost of omeprazole without insurance?

What is the cost of omeprazole without insurance?

between $8 and $110
Omeprazole is the generic name but can be found under the brand name Prilosec or Prilosec OTC. Costs vary, depending on whether it is prescribed or purchased OTC and depending on the form and quantity. Without insurance, omeprazole costs between $8 and $110 without insurance or any discounts.

Is omeprazole DR 20 mg over the counter?

Omeprazole is used to treat frequent heartburn by reducing the acid in the stomach. This version of omeprazole is available over the counter; however, to receive the discounted prices below, you will need to present a doctor’s prescription and purchase at the pharmacy counter.

Is omeprazole bad for your kidneys?

In recent years, the use of proton pump inhibitors (PPI), especially omeprazole, has been associated with development of chronic kidney disease (CKD). These drugs are widely used worldwide. Quais são os efeitos colaterais do omeprazol?

Aproximadamente 1% dos pacientes sofrem efeitos colaterais com uso de curto prazo do omeprazol. Os mais comuns são dor de cabeça, náuseas, diarreia, prisão de ventre, fadiga, mal-estar, dores musculares e ansiedade. Em raras ocasiões, ocorrem casos de trombocitopenia, neutropenia, ginecomastia, anemia hemolítica e agranulocitose.
